Output 68e86d477483b23a6a5996739dd3cb7aa1e5a6252871627160c57c26c1baf91a:0

value
1610000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f03cf769e8932b28c060318107d6425d0135b85 OP_EQUALVERIFY OP_CHECKSIG
address
1JQzdPgfvWDAJQe94qJdRueRUvjLyRzRSU
transaction
68e86d477483b23a6a5996739dd3cb7aa1e5a6252871627160c57c26c1baf91a
spent
true